鸟语天空
Python常用命令
post by:追风剑情 2026-4-9 15:22

一、安装Anaconda

Windows shell installer

# 在cmd窗口执行
curl https://repo.anaconda.com/archive/Anaconda3-2025.12-2-Windows-x86_64.exe --output .\Anaconda3-2025.12-2-Windows-x86_64.exe

# 在PowerShell窗口执行
Invoke-WebRequest -Uri "https://repo.anaconda.com/archive/Anaconda3-2025.12-2-Windows-x86_64.exe" -OutFile ".\Anaconda3-2025.12-2-Windows-x86_64.exe"  

增加环境变量
{安装路径}\Anaconda
{安装路径}\Anaconda\Scripts
{安装路径}\Anaconda\Library\bin

二、配置镜像地址

# 配置清华镜像源(国内最快最稳定)
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/conda-forge/
conda config --set show_channel_urls yes
# 清除索引缓存,使配置生效
conda clean -i
# 验证配置是否成功
conda config --show channels  

三、初始化命令窗口

# 为 cmd.exe 初始化 conda,需要以管理员身份重新打开cmd窗口
conda init cmd.exe
# 为 PowerShell 初始化 conda,需要以管理员身份重新打开PowerShell窗口
conda init powershell  

四、创建虚拟环境

# 创建一个 Python 3.12 的环境
conda create -n pyocc-env python=3.12
# 激活虚拟环境
conda activate pyocc-env
# 删除环境
conda env remove -n pyocc-env
# 查看当前环境列表
conda env list
# 查看当前激活的环境,前面有*
conda info --envs 
# 退出当前环境
conda deactivate  

五、安装 pythonOCC

# 创建一个 Python 3.12 的环境并安装 pythonOCC
conda create -n pyocc-env python=3.12
# 为 cmd.exe 初始化 conda,需要以管理员身份重新打开cmd窗口
conda init cmd.exe
# 为 PowerShell 初始化 conda,需要以管理员身份重新打开PowerShell窗口
conda init powershell
# 激活虚拟环境
conda activate pyocc-env
# 删除环境
conda env remove -n pyocc-env
# 安装 pythonocc
conda install -c conda-forge pythonocc-core=7.9.0 

# 查看 conda 版本
conda --version
# 查看当前环境列表
conda env list
# 查看当前激活的环境,前面有*
conda info --envs 
# 退出当前环境
conda deactivate
# 清理 conda 缓存
conda clean --all -y  

六、pip 命令

# 为pip设置全局镜像下载地址(这里以清华源为例)
pip config set global.index-url https://pypi.tuna.tsinghua.edu.cn/simple
pip config set global.trusted-host pypi.tuna.tsinghua.edu.cn
# 下载时指定镜像地址,以清华源为例
pip install scikit-learn jieba -i https://pypi.tuna.tsinghua.edu.cn/simple
# 查看已安装的所有依赖包列表
pip list
# 过滤返回的依赖包列表
pip list | grep pandas  # Linux/macOS,查找pandas包
pip list | findstr pandas  # Windows,查找pandas包
# 检查可更新的包
pip list --outdated
# 检查已安装的包之间是否存在依赖冲突
pip check
# 导入所有依赖包列表到文件
pip freeze > requirements.txt
# 在新环境中使用依赖文件批量安装
pip install -r requirements.txt
# 查看特定包信息
pip show <包名>  

七、ollama 命令

# 启动ollama
net start ollama
# 停止ollama
net stop ollama
# 启动服务
ollama serve
# 启动服务,允许局域网中其它电脑访问
ollama serve --host 0.0.0.0
# 查看模型列表
ollama list
# 查看当前运行的模型
ollama ps
# 先查看模型详细信息
ollama show deepseek-rl:7b
# 删除模型
ollama rm deepseek-rl:7b
# 拉取模型
ollama pull deepseek-rl:7b
# 让模型常驻显存,-1在windows下会报错
ollama run qwen3-vl:8b --keepalive -1
# 让模型在显示中停留一段时间
ollama run qwen3-vl:8b --keepalive 2h # 停留2小时
# 手动停止模型
ollama stop qwen3-vl:8b 
# 可在浏览器中访问,若能访问会显示 “Ollama is running”
http://192.168.31.201:11434/  
评论:
发表评论:
昵称

邮件地址 (选填)

个人主页 (选填)

内容